LA QUINTA, Calif. - Nevada Men's Golfer Liam Gobin, the junior from Liverpool, England, closed out what was an exceptional three days recording an even-par 71, bringing his 54-hole score to 209 (-4), as he finished tied for 17th overall in a prolific field of 120 golfers. The T17 finish marked Gobin's best finish as a member of the Wolf Pack program.
As a team, Nevada shot 297 (+13), and the Pack finished in the 22nd position on the team leaderboard with a three round score of 875 (+23).Â
Gobin was incredibly consistent throughout the final round, as he recorded 16 pars, one birdie, and one bogey. Gobin had by far his best outing at the Division I level after transferring to Nevada from McLennan CC ahead of the 2023-24 season. Gobin's score of 209 surpassed his previous best mark of 220, which he earned at the Visit Stockton Pacific Invitational this past fall.Â
Enrique Dimayuga finished second in the Wolf Pack lineup and tied for 66th overall with a score of 217 (+4) throughout the event. Dimayuga closed out the tournament with a final round score of 74 (+3). The senior recorded nine pars and three birdies across the final 18 holes.Â
Freshman Jonathan Kim finished just one stroke back of Dimayuga on the final leaderboard, as he recorded a 54-hole score of 218 (+5) and finished the event tied for 72nd. Kim shot 74 on Wednesday, and he tallied 10 pars and three birdies during the third round.Â
Tom Patterson and Ryan Sear each carded scores of 78 (+7) for the final round of the tournament, and Patterson finished in 118th at +18 for the event, while Sear concluded The Prestige in 119th at +20.
Individual Competition
In the individual competition, Keita Okada had another strong day to close out the event, as he carded a 71 (-1) for the final round and finished tied for 16th at even par. Okada had 13 pars and three birdies across the final 18 holes.Â
Supakit (Oak) Seelanagae had his best round of the week on Wednesday, recording a score of 70 (-2) after tallying 14 pars, three birdies, and just one bogey to close out the tournament. Seelanagae concluded the event tied for 21st with a three round score of 217 (+1).
Alex Maxwell shot 74 (+2) on Wednesday, and he finished the event tied for 27th with a 54-hole score of 219 (+3).Â
Aaron Leach carded a 78 (+6) for the final round, and he ended the event tied for 55th at +18.Â

Up Next
Nevada will return to the course on Monday, March 11, when the Pack will head to Malibu, California to participate in The Saticoy Showdown, a one-day event hosted by Pepperdine at The Saticoy Club.
